THE GRACE ESTATE. Messrs. Harcourt announce the auction sale to take plaoe on Friday, December 10, at 2.30 p.m., of tho subdivision of the above estate situated in Hawkestone Street, Thorndon, comprising some three acres of lawn, gardens, and shrubberies, which have been subdivided into 14 superb building sites, ranging from 13 perches upwards. The auctioneers state that this comprises the last of the old residential gardens wii:hin the city, and offers a unique opportunity of acquiring a freehold buildin? site close to the wharves, railway stations, and business area.
